Advantages of Low-Cost Online Training

Low-cost online training for workforce development presents numerous advantages that are pivotal for both employers and employees. Firstly, it serves as a cost-effective means to enhance the skills of the workforce without the need to allocate extensive budgets for offsite training or specialized instructors. This is particularly beneficial for small and medium-sized enterprises (SMEs) striving to optimize resources while still fostering an environment of continuous learning. Furthermore, online training platforms often provide a wide range of courses, enabling employees to select topics that best suit their personal and professional development needs. With the convenience of accessing training materials remotely, employees can undertake these courses from any location, which significantly minimizes disruptions to their regular work schedules. Lastly, low-cost online training for workforce development is scalable, allowing organizations to train multiple employees simultaneously, thereby boosting overall productivity and efficiency.

Implementing Online Training Solutions

Implementing low-cost online training for workforce requires strategic planning. Businesses must first assess the specific training needs of their employees to ensure that the selected courses align with organizational goals. This involves identifying key competencies that need enhancement and seeking affordable online platforms that offer such programs. Subsequently, organizations should consider the technical infrastructure available to employees, ensuring that they have access to the necessary devices and internet connectivity to partake in the courses. Additionally, ongoing evaluation of the training outcomes is essential to measure their effectiveness and make necessary adjustments. Commitment to these steps will enable businesses to successfully integrate low-cost online training into their workforce development strategies.

Challenges in Online Training Implementation

Implementing low-cost online training for workforce development is not without its challenges. One significant hurdle is ensuring that employees remain engaged and motivated throughout the training process, given the self-directed nature of online learning. Additionally, organizations must address potential technological barriers, such as inadequate access to devices or stable internet connections for all employees. Another challenge lies in evaluating the effectiveness of the training programs, as traditional metrics may not accurately reflect the knowledge gained through online courses. Despite these challenges, the benefits of implementing low-cost online training largely outweigh the difficulties, particularly when organizations employ strategic planning and ensure ongoing support for their employees throughout the training process.
